GreenLane AutoCare: WhatsApp Booking Bot Streamlines MOTs and Servicing

Overview

GreenLane AutoCare introduced a WhatsApp chatbot to simplify how customers ask questions and book MOTs and servicing. The bot recognises returning customers by their phone number, looks up their vehicles and past work, offers available times, confirms bookings, and keeps customers updated while their car is in the workshop. It also shares MOT results the moment they are recorded. The result is a faster, friendlier customer journey and a smoother day for the workshop team.

What customers can do in minutes

  • Ask about services: Clear explanations of MOTs and standard services, what’s included, and how long it takes.
  • Get car-specific guidance: The bot uses in-depth automotive know-how to help with common issues (warning lights, service intervals, unusual noises) and advises when a physical inspection is needed.
  • Be recognised instantly: Returning customers are identified by their WhatsApp number, so the bot can see their vehicles and previous visits.
  • See prices for MOTs and standard services: Transparent costs upfront for these items. For any additional work, it explains that a technician will inspect the vehicle and provide a quote before proceeding.
  • Book MOTs and servicing: Real-time access to the garage’s calendar to offer suitable dates and times, then confirm the booking and share arrival instructions.
  • Receive live updates: Status notifications when the car is checked in, being worked on, awaiting approval, and ready for collection.
  • Get MOT results: Pass or fail details, with any advisories listed so customers know what to do next.

Respecting quoting boundaries

The bot shares clear prices for MOTs and standard services only. For everything else, it sets the right expectation: a technician will inspect the car and provide a quote before any additional costs are approved. This builds trust and prevents misunderstandings.

Simple staff workflow

Service advisors arrive to a clean, confirmed diary with customer and vehicle details complete. If plans change, the bot offers rescheduling options and updates the calendar. Advisors can trigger status updates with a tap during check-in, while-in-bay, and ready-for-collection stages, keeping customers informed without extra phone calls.

Results

  • 35% fewer inbound calls about routine questions and availability.
  • 22% increase in online bookings for MOTs and standard services within eight weeks.
  • 18% fewer no-shows thanks to reminders and easy rescheduling.
  • Faster turnaround from clearer diaries and fewer interruptions, improving overall customer satisfaction.
